Philosophy 215: Asian Philosophy
I will be teaching Asian Philosophy which will use the Awakenings book by Bresnan and basically cover the whole book: Early Vedic/Upanishadic thought, some modern Hindu thought, Buddhist thought in India, China and Japan as well as some Confucianism and Taoism. Most of the course will deal with philosophical themes in a comparative way with western ideas and in comparison between the areas of Asian tradition. The class will be mostly lecture and discussion.
Humanities 220: Asian Humanities
I will also be teaching the Asian Humanities course and it is centered on three traditions of India : Hinduism, Buddhism and Sikhism. We should cover most of Indian history from the ancient time to the present dealing with philosophy, the development of art, popular narratives/literature as well as political issues. This class is more project based but will still use lecture and discussion as the primary methods of teaching. We will use an Indian History book as well as the Literatures of Asia book.
